敏捷开发管理项目中的团队协作模式有哪些?

敏捷开发管理项目中的团队协作模式是项目成功的关键因素之一。在敏捷开发中,团队协作模式的多样性使得项目能够更好地适应快速变化的需求和市场环境。以下是几种常见的敏捷开发管理项目中的团队协作模式:

一、Scrum模式

Scrum是一种迭代、增量的敏捷开发方法,强调团队协作和自组织。Scrum模式中的团队协作模式主要包括以下几个方面:

  1. 产品负责人(Product Owner):负责定义和优先级排序产品需求,确保团队开发的产品满足客户需求。

  2. Scrum Master:负责推动Scrum流程,确保团队遵循Scrum原则,协调团队与其他部门之间的沟通。

  3. 开发团队(Development Team):由具备不同技能的成员组成,负责实现产品需求。

  4. 站会、回顾会、规划会:站会用于团队沟通,回顾会用于总结经验教训,规划会用于制定下一迭代计划。

二、Kanban模式

Kanban是一种可视化的工作管理方法,强调限制工作在流程中的数量,提高工作效率。Kanban模式中的团队协作模式主要包括以下几个方面:

  1. 柱状图(Kanban Board):用于展示工作流程和任务状态,团队成员可以通过柱状图了解工作进度。

  2. 工作项(Work Item):包括待办、进行中、测试、完成等状态,团队成员根据工作项状态进行协作。

  3. 工作流(Work Flow):定义工作项在流程中的移动规则,确保工作有序进行。

  4. 精益看板(Lean Kanban):通过限制工作在流程中的数量,提高工作效率。

三、LeSS模式

LeSS(Large-Scale Scrum)是一种适用于大型项目的Scrum方法,强调团队协作和自组织。LeSS模式中的团队协作模式主要包括以下几个方面:

  1. 产品负责人(Product Owner):负责定义和优先级排序产品需求,确保团队开发的产品满足客户需求。

  2. Scrum Master:负责推动Scrum流程,确保团队遵循Scrum原则,协调团队与其他部门之间的沟通。

  3. 团队(Team):由多个Scrum团队组成,每个团队负责一部分产品需求。

  4. 整体回顾(Overall Retrospective):LeSS团队定期进行整体回顾,总结经验教训,优化团队协作。

四、SAFe模式

SAFe(Scaled Agile Framework)是一种适用于大型组织、复杂项目的敏捷开发框架。SAFe模式中的团队协作模式主要包括以下几个方面:

  1. 产品经理(Product Manager):负责定义和优先级排序产品需求,确保团队开发的产品满足客户需求。

  2. 站点(Portfolio):由多个团队组成,负责实现特定产品或服务。

  3. 站点级Scrum团队(Portfolio Team):负责实现站点级需求。

  4. 站点级Scrum Master:负责推动站点级Scrum流程,确保团队遵循Scrum原则。

  5. 整体回顾(Overall Retrospective):SAFe团队定期进行整体回顾,总结经验教训,优化团队协作。

五、看板方法(Lean Kanban)

看板方法是一种可视化的工作管理方法,强调限制工作在流程中的数量,提高工作效率。看板方法中的团队协作模式主要包括以下几个方面:

  1. 看板板(Kanban Board):用于展示工作流程和任务状态,团队成员可以通过看板板了解工作进度。

  2. 工作项(Work Item):包括待办、进行中、测试、完成等状态,团队成员根据工作项状态进行协作。

  3. 工作流(Work Flow):定义工作项在流程中的移动规则,确保工作有序进行。

  4. 精益看板(Lean Kanban):通过限制工作在流程中的数量,提高工作效率。

总之,敏捷开发管理项目中的团队协作模式多种多样,企业应根据自身项目特点、团队规模和需求选择合适的模式。通过有效的团队协作,提高项目开发效率,确保项目成功。

猜你喜欢:绩效管理系统